For 100 V series
(4) Unlatch the power cord bushing and pull it up from the AC cord holder. Then release the
power cord from the cable guides provided on the AC cord holder (shown on
(5) Remove the power supply shield from the lower MJ/PS shield.
(6) Remove three screws "k" from the power supply PCB.
(7) Detach the PS PCB insulator from the power cord.
(8) Remove the AC cord holder from the lower MJ/PS shield.
For MFC
(9) Remove screw "l" and remove the MJ shield from the lower MJ/PS shield.
(10) Remove screw "m"* from the MJ PCB* and take it off the lower MJ/PS shield.
(11) Remove the MJ PCB insulator* from the lower MJ/PS shield.
